14:22 — Canary gating rules for Driftway plugins tightened. Plugins failing two consecutive health probes are now auto-rolled back; no manual override. External authors: your canary slice dropped from 5% to 2% during incident review. Gating decisions are logged per plugin version, not per deploy. If your plugin was rolled back between 14:02 and 14:22, resubmit against the new gate. The gating build that enforced this is recorded below.

trace token, tawep-fahif: htk3_b58

Quick context for the sync: the cron drift saga on Tillersoft's batch cluster continues. Jobs scheduled at :00 are firing up to 40 seconds late because the scheduler node syncs NTP only hourly. We've shortened the sync interval on two nodes as a test. New folks: skim the investigation timeline before poking anything. The full write-up lives on the internal page linked below.

wiki page, fahaf-yagag: https://confluence.qorvellabs.internal/pages/display/pages/display

**Ticket: Expired creds blocking soft-delete cleanup — Orderly**

Hey team — the nightly job that sweeps soft-deleted rows from the `orders` table in Orderly stopped Tuesday. Turns out the service credential for the Purgeline API expired, so rows flagged `deleted_at` are piling up and skewing support dashboards. Don't manually delete anything; the sweep handles audit trails. Ops minted a replacement credential this morning. Until the vault sync finishes, use the temporary Purgeline key below.

gateway credential: kto3_qfe

## Bulk edit support for the Ledgerkite admin table

This PR adds multi-row selection and batched mutations to the accounts grid. Edits are chunked to avoid lock contention, and each chunk retries with exponential backoff on conflict. I kept the optimistic UI path but added a rollback handler for partial failures. Chunk sizing and retry behavior are governed by the constants below.

tuning table, kajog-bawip:
TIERS = {
    "kelius": 256,
    "lammir": 543,
}

## Queue-Depth Autoscaler

The Wrenfield autoscaler watches the Ashgrove job queue and scales workers when depth exceeds the configured watermark for three consecutive polls. Future maintainers: the watermark lives in the scaler config, not the worker image, so changes require a config release rather than a rebuild. Scale-down is deliberately slow to avoid thrash. Config releases are only accepted by the controller when signed; generate the signature with the key provided below.

rollout seal: bky4_x7Gc